How much do permanent network buyer j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 25, 2026, the average yearly pay for permanent network buyer in the United States is $68,384.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$55,000.00 and $79,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Position Overview:
The Supply Chain orchestration from customer to supplier requires a strong operational partner to manage, measure and maintain business relations with external supply chain partners. The Strategic Buyer - Networks is responsible for complex procurement of custom products and services and related supply chain aspects such as purchase orders, inbound volumes, spend, procurement volumes, forecast and capacity commits and supplier performance and compliance, with a focus on non-standard, non-repeat buying, including stranger / alien programs. The Buyer's focus lies on new and defined suppliers for a range of products procured from outside of Eaton.
Job Responsibilities:
• Procure parts and services with complex or custom requirements, with a focus on non-standard, non-repeat buying, including stranger / alien programs.
• Drive the part deactivation and reactivation processes to include obsolescence as required to meet customer demands.
• Collaborate in Aftermarket quoting process with commercial teams
• Accountable for managing the producibility decision process for the plant (dormant parts / "none" process / supplier unknown).
• Manage in-site transitions (supplier movement / gate processes / ramp up / ramp down) based on risk matrix.
• Manage all technical procurement activities associated with ITAR & Other undisclosed programs.
• Receive, validate and communicate Engineering Specs for parts with support of Engineering -ITAR & Other undisclosed programs.
• Engage suppliers in tender preparation and align on responsibilities for delivery.
• Manage Material Forecast collaboration and receive capacity commits from suppliers.
